Markets in Nou Barris
Nou Barris has several municipal markets — Guineueta, Núria, Trinitat — that supply the working-class neighborhoods of upper Barcelona. Here we highlight the Mercat de la Guineueta.
Mercat de la Guineueta
A neighborhood market of the Nou Barris district
- Working-class neighborhood
- Since 1965
- Nou Barris district
A neighborhood market in the Guineueta area, founded in 1965 with the construction of the neighborhood. Traditional stalls that supply the residents of the Nou Barris district. Together with the Núria and Trinitat markets, it forms the network of working-class markets of upper Barcelona.
A working-class neighborhood market. Saturday morning fills with Nou Barris district locals doing their shopping.
